Information on the case from local sources, may or may not be correct : Lisa was last seen riding her bicycle in Walnut Creek, California at 7:00 p.m. on September 5, 1976. She was en route from her home in the 100 block of Los Cerros to a nearby BART (Bay Area Rapid Transit) station at the time.
She was supposed to return home by 8:00 p.m., but did not and has never been heard from again. Her parents reported her missing at 9:00 p.m.
Lisa's bicycle was found in a grove of walnut trees at Heather Farms Park, near the Contra Costa Canal, three hours after she was last seen. A search of the canal turned up no clues as to her whereabouts, but witnesses said they had seen her at the park's entrance.
Several witnesses reported seeing a Caucasian man driving a medium-sized motorcycle on Ygnacio Valley Road at the intersection of Walnut Avenue, two blocks east of Heather Farms Park, at approximately 7:30 p.m.
The man wasn't wearing a helmet and is described as being in his early forties, with brown curly hair, a mustache and a chunky build. A Caucasian female child wearing a white helmet, Age at the time of disappearance: d between eight and twelve years old, was riding the motorcycle with him. It hasn't been verified that the child was Lisa, and the man's identity has never been confirmed.
Louis Richard Fresquez is the prime suspect in Lisa's disappearance. A photo of him is posted with this case summary. He was born in 1942, making him 34 years old in 1976. He is 5'5 and 140 pounds, with black hair and brown eyes.
Fresquez was imprisoned for Gender : crimes between 1987 and 2012. He has never been charged in connection with Lisa's case due to a lack of evidence.
She is missing under suspicious circumstances and her case remains unsolved.

A missing person is a person who has disappeared and whose status as alive or dead cannot be confirmed as their location and condition are not known. A person may go missing through a voluntary disappearance, or else due to an accident, crime, death in a location where they cannot be found (such as at sea), or many other reasons. In most parts of the world, a missing person will usually be found quickly. While criminal abductions are some of the most widely reported missing person cases, these account for only 2�5% of missing children in Europe. By contrast, some missing person cases remain unresolved for many years. Laws related to these cases are often complex since, in many jurisdictions, relatives and third parties may not deal with a person's assets until their death is considered proven by law and a formal death certificate issued. The situation, uncertainties, and lack of closure or a funeral resulting when a person goes missing may be extremely painful with long-lasting effects on family and friends. Several organizations seek to connect, share best practices, and disseminate information and imAge at the time of disappearance: s of missing children to improve the effectiveness of missing children investigations, including the International Commission on Missing Persons, the International Centre for Missing & Exploited Children (ICMEC), as well as national organizations, including the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children in the US, Missing People in the UK, Child Focus in Belgium, and The Smile of the Child in Greece.
